首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Blazor VS 传统Web应用程序

与传统的Web应用程序相比,改善了用户交互体验,浏览器可以屏幕执行数据的部分更新,并且每次调用都没有HTML传输,许多传统的Web应用程序开始部分集成Ajax,开发人员在后端定义API接口,然后前端...Blazor允许C#开发人员使用Visual Studio进行构建和调试,而TypeScript主要将开发人员与VS Code联系在一起。Visual Studio工具集通常是C#开发人员更熟悉的。...Blazor托管模型 区分Blazor托管模型和页面渲染很重要,客户端模型中,Blazor浏览器内部的WebAssembly(WASM)运行,服务器端模型中,Blazor服务器运行,并通过Signal-R...服务器模式的优点 •初始页面下载可以小很多•可以利用已安装的服务器端组件进行处理•Visual Studio完全支持使用服务器端模型进行调试 服务器模式的缺点 •没有离线功能,断开互联网连接后,处理将停止...•延迟增加 客户端模式的优点 •客户端UI处理,可以减少对服务器的压力•当用户比较多时,服务器不用去管理很多的Socket连接•比Js 有更好的处理性能 客户端模式的缺点 •WASM的.NET目前还没有发挥其全部性能潜力

3.8K10

Visual Studio 调试系列12 远程调试部署远程计算机IIS的ASP.NET应用程序

本文包括Windows服务器设置IIS的基本配置以及从Visual Studio部署应用程序的步骤。包括这些步骤以确保服务器已安装所需的组件,应用程序可以正确运行,以及您已准备好进行远程调试。...》 11 设置 Windows Server 的远程调试器 参考《Visual Studio 调试系列11 远程调试》 12 从 Visual Studio 计算机附加到 ASP.NET 应用程序...Visual Studio 计算机上,打开要调试的解决方案 (MyASPApp您按照这篇文章中的步骤)。... Visual Studio 中,单击调试 > 附加到进程(Ctrl + Alt + P)。...应在 Visual Studio 中命中断点。 13 故障排除:Windows Server 打开所需的端口 大多数设置中,通过安装ASP.NET和远程调试器来打开所需的端口。

3.9K10
您找到你想要的搜索结果了吗?
是的
没有找到

Blazor VS 传统Web应用程序

[clipboard_20210109_051157.png] 传统Web应用程序 传统的Web应用程序是很少或没有客户端处理的应用程序。HTML服务器端渲染并传递到浏览器。...与传统的Web应用程序相比,改善了用户交互体验,浏览器可以屏幕执行数据的部分更新,并且每次调用都没有HTML传输,许多传统的Web应用程序开始部分集成Ajax,开发人员在后端定义API接口,然后前端...Blazor允许C#开发人员使用Visual Studio进行构建和调试,而TypeScript主要将开发人员与VS Code联系在一起。Visual Studio工具集通常是C#开发人员更熟悉的。...)运行,服务器端模型中,Blazor服务器运行,并通过Signal-R将HTML传输到客户端。...[clipboard_20210109_045124.png] 服务器模式的优点 初始页面下载可以小很多 可以利用已安装的服务器端组件进行处理 Visual Studio完全支持使用服务器端模型进行调试

4.2K10

ASP.NET Core远程调试

关于ASP.NET Core远程调试的具体做法可参考微软文档——Remote Debug ASP.NET Core on a Remote IIS Computer in Visual Studio 2017...体验Web Deploy 这种发布方式可直接将代码打包发到指定服务器的指定站点下,十分方便。...远程调试注意事项 若要使用远程调试功能,需同时满足以下亮点: 必须以Debug方式发布代码到服务器 本地项目文件夹中的文件必须和服务器的文件一致(主要是bin下的dll文件了) 个人感受...上图是远程调试原理图,若VS长时间无法响应服务器会报502错误 ? 微软文档中对于使用远程调试的网络要求:不要用代理,确保有良好的带宽与网速 ?...推荐阅读 Remote Debugging Remote Debug ASP.NET Core on a Remote IIS Computer in Visual Studio 2017 版权声明 本文为作者原创

1.5K30

.NET程序员必备的58个提高效率工具

Web Essentials:提高生产力和帮助高效编写 CSS,Java,HTML 等 MSVSMON:远程调试监视器(msvsmon.exe)是一个 Visual Studio 连接进行远程调试的小型应用程序...远程调试时,Visual Studio 运行在一台计算机(调试器主机),远程调试监视器运行与你正在调试的应用程序运行在一台远程计算机上。...Indent Guides:每个缩进级别添加垂直线。 PowerShell Tools:一套用于开发和调试 PowerShell 脚本以及 Visual Studio 2015中模块的工具。...Visual Studio Code:免费的跨平台编辑器,用来构建和调试现代 web 和云的应用程序。...这包括请求数据(例如 HTTP 响应头和表单 GET 和 POST 数据)和响应数据(包括 HTTP 响应头和正文)。 14. 诊断 Glimpse:提供服务器端诊断数据。

4K60

【学习过程】寻找合适的WebGIS开发构架

通过它可以: 显示一幅定制的专业的地图 服务器端执行一个GIS model并且客户端显示结果 ArcGIS Online base map显示自己的数据 GIS数据中搜索要素以及属性并显示结果...当你用Visual Studio 环境编写JavaScript代码时,很多以前提供给.NET开发人员的用来提高编写代码体验的功能都没有用了,比如:代码智能提示,代码自动完成,交互式气泡帮助这些好功能都没有了...当你用Visual Studio 环境编写JavaScript代码时,很多以前提供给.NET开发人员的用来提高编写代码体验的功能都没有用了,比如:代码智能提示,代码自动完成,交互式气泡帮助这些好功能都没有了...关于如何调试JS,开始也是一个困扰笔者的问题,后来找到了一个简单的方法,就是在你要调试的JS脚本语句前面加上一句debugger;当浏览器解释到这一句的时候,就会自动中断进入调试状态,如果你安装了Visual...Studio,那么会有弹出对话框提示你启动VS程序对JS代码进行调试,然后就可以像调试普通编译型语句那样查看中间变量的值了。

1K20

第1章 ASP.NET4.0开发技术概述

简述服务器端动态网页技术的工作流程。 具体流程如下: ① 浏览者客户端浏览器地址栏中输入一个HTTP请求,该请求通过网络从浏览器传送到Web服务器中。 ② Web服务器服务器中定位指令文件。...其缺点是,没有对组件的支持,扩展性较差。 (4)ASP.NET ASP.NET是建立.NET框架基础之上的Web程序设计框架,它用来创建Web应用程序。...ASP.NET运行在Web服务器,为开发内容丰富的、动态的、个性化的Web站点提供了一种方法。...简述Visual Studio 2010开发环境中各窗口的基本功能。 (1)菜单栏和工具栏中包含了所有的操作命令,提供了进行Visual Studio 2010各项功能选择的主要途径。...(6)工具箱是放置支持Visual Studio 2010开发的各页面控件,拖拉工具箱的各控件到页面中,则页面将自动创建该控件。

1.5K20

微软再出手!这次要干翻 IDEA 了。。

点击关注公众号,Java干货及时送达 来源|OSC开源社区(ID:oschina2013) 不久前,微软开发者博客中透露了 Visual Studio Code Java 2022 年的开发路线图...除了提升编写代码的体验,微软还将进一步改善开发者的调试体验。 2022 年,VS Code 将允许开发者对反编译的类进行调试变量视图和 lambda 表达式评估中更快地进行评估。...目前的 Spring Boot 扩展包(Spring Boot Extension Pack)包含许多优化 Visual Studio Code Spring 开发体验的功能。...如今有很多学生开发者也 Visual Studio Code 中使用 Java,所以微软也计划为这个群体做出一些针对性的改进,比如为没有构建工具的项目提供更好的 JUnit 测试端到端体验,为 JavaFX...反馈和建议 2022 年,Visual Studio Code 估计还将会针对 Java 开发作出非常多的更新。

35840

.Net 高效开发之不可错过的实用工具 工欲善其事,必先利其器,没有好的工具,怎么能高效的开发出高质量的代码呢?本文为各ASP.NET 开发者介绍一些高效实用的工具,涉及SQL 管理,VS插件,内

Visual Studio Visual Studio Productivity Power tool: VS 专业版的效率工具。...远程调试期间,VS 调试主机运行,MSVSMON 远程机器中运行。 WIX toolset: 可以将XML 源代码文件编译成Windows 安装包。...Visual Studio Code: 免费的跨平台编辑器,可以编译和调试现代的Web和云应用。 ASP.NET Fiddler: 能够捕获 http 请求/响应来模拟请求行为。...ASPhere: Web.config 图形化编辑器 ComponentOne Studio for ASP.NET 一整套完备的开发工具包,用于各种浏览器中创建和设计具有现代风格的Web应用程序...通过FileZilla 客户端可以将文件上传到FTP 服务器。 TreeTrim: TreeTrim 是调整代码的工具,能够删除一些无效的debug文件和临时文件等。

3.4K60

.NET Web应用配置本地IIS(实现Visual Studio离线运行与调试

而且有时候前端也需要及时的对接我们的接口,导致每次修改一点东西都要发布一次,这样子对于开发者而言是十分的浪费时间,工作效率也十分的低下。...所以我们把.NET应用配置本地IIS,实现程序能够直接托管IIS并且运行程序可以调试。...安装IIS托管服务器 前提: Windows10 IIS Web服务器安装配置 IIS中添加本地项目的站点 打开Internet Information Services (IIS)管理器=>...添加网站=>配置本地项目站点 项目配置本地IIS运行: 配置完成后,我们可以不需要运行Visual Studio中的项目可以直接浏览IIS中站点即可查看页面或者api效果,假如需要调试的话可以运行...Visual Studio中的项目直接调试既可以。

78810

跨平台开发体验: Windows

一、添加引用 我们直接利用Visual Studio 打开前面这个helloworld.csproj项目文件。...Visual Studio中修改项目文件非常方便,我们只需要右键选择目标项目,并从弹出的菜单中选择“Edit Project File”就可以了。...KestrelServer是一款跨平台的Web服务器,可以Windows、Mac OS和Linux使用。...HTTP.sys则是一种只能在Windows平台使用的Web服务器,由于它本质是一个操作系统内核模式运行的驱动,所以能够提供非常好的性能。...该文件不需要手工进行编辑,当前项目属性对话框(通过解决方案对话框中右击选择“属性(Properties)”选项)中“调试(Debug)”选项卡下的所有设置最终都会体现在该文件。 ?

1.6K30

如何从Node.js开始-Visual Studio2017

如何从Node.js开始 好吧,简单地说,Node.js是一个服务器框架,可以Windows,Linux,Unix,Mac OS X等各种平台上运行。它是开源的。...可以V8的公共Wiki找到更多信息。 如何开始 我们需要安装和设置NodeJS开发环境才能使用。 进入NodeJS页面下载MSI文件。 ? 点击“下一步”完成设置。...当我们计划使用Visual Studio开发示例应用程序时,请确保IDE已安装NodeJS开发包。 Visual Studio中使用NodeJS 打开Visual Studio2017。...服务器将在浏览器中响应以下输出。 ? 现在,如果要根据用户请求提供HTML页面,则需要使用不同的NodeJS框架。...使用npm安装express.js $ npm install express --save Visual Studio中安装Express.js ?

3K90

IIS服务器应用程序不可用解决技巧

这个问题见了好几次,.net下 Microsoft visual 2005->visual studio tools->visual studio 2005命令提示下输入aspnet_regiis -...2)如果选择调试,显示如下图: 尝试: 想了想,问题是突然出现的,其间没有安装什么软件,也没有中病毒,奇怪了。...若根据”ExecutionEngineException”google查来的结果是“无药可救”,做好“最坏打算”,重装!。...4.“应用程序池ID”文本框中键入AppPool1。 5.单击“确定”。 将应用程序分配到应用程序池 1.单击“开始”,指向“程序”,然后单击“控制面板”。...这个问题见了好几次,.net下 Microsoft visual 2005->visual studio tools->visual studio 2005命令提示下输入aspnet_regiis -

1.5K60

14款Java开发工具【面试+工作】

NetBeans 3.5.1基础,Sun开发出了Java One Studio5,为用户提供了一个更加先进的企业编程环境。...4)Jbuilder能用Servlet和JSP开发和调试动态Web 应用。   5)利用Jbuilder可创建(没有专有代码和标记)纯Java2应用。...JRun是第一个完全支持JSP 1.0 规格书的商业化产品,全球有超过80,000名开发人员使用JRun在他们已有的Web服务器添加服务器端Java的功能。...JSP是一种强大的服务器端技术,它是用于创建复杂Web应用的一整套快速应用开发系统。JRun可以使我们开始开发并测试Java应用。...理论上来说,它有些类似于(Unix)C中的make ,但没有make的缺陷。因为Ant的原作者多种(硬件)平台上开发软件时,无法忍受这些工具的限制和不便。

2.3K50
领券